Обновления JAICP в ноябре 2022
Новое
- Прямая интеграция с WhatsApp.
- Новый операторский чат от Just AI — Aimychat.
- Группы проектов.
- Теги активации
intentGroup
иintentGroup!
. - Изменение таймаута при событии
speechNotRecognized
.
Изменения
- Обновление модели управления доступами.
- Конфигурационный файл NLU переименован в
nlu.json
.
Прямая интеграция с WhatsApp
В JAICP появилась возможность прямой интеграции с мессенжером WhatsApp. Теперь вы можете подключить бота к своему бизнес‑аккаунту WhatsApp напрямую через приложение в аккаунте разработчика.
Вы по-прежнему можете настроить интеграцию с помощью провайдеров edna и i-Digital.
Новый операторский чат — Aimychat
Мы выпустили новый продукт — операторский чат Aimychat. Его основные преимущества:
-
У Aimychat простой и понятный интерфейс для оператора.
-
Вы можете объединять операторов в группы и просматривать статистику обращений клиентов.
-
Для авторизации не нужен отдельный аккаунт — вы можете зайти под вашей учетной записью для любого продукта экосистемы Conversational Cloud.
Узнайте больше о преимуществах и работе с Aimychat в его документации.
Вы можете подключить Aimychat в качестве операторского канала в JAICP. Для этого:
- Настройте Aimychat.
- Подключите операторский канал в JAICP.
- Настройте перевод на оператора в сценарии вашего бота.
Группы проектов
В ноябрьском обновлении JAICP мы добавили возможность объединять проекты в независимые группы для удобства совместной работы.
Теперь вы можете создавать группы проектов, приглашать в них пользователей: как зарегистрированных пользователей продуктов Conversational Cloud, так и новых, и назначать им необходимые роли. Пользователи могут работать в нескольких группах проектов и свободно переключаться между ними.
Кроме того, есть возможность получать еженедельные email-отчеты по ботам в конкретной группе проектов.
Теги активации intentGroup и intentGroup!
Теги объявляют группу интентов для перехода в стейт.
После тега пишется путь к интенту,
но в отличие от тегов intent
и intent!
, переход в стейт будет происходить только при срабатывании интентов, вложенных в объявленный.
Новые теги активации можно использовать, чтобы:
- Активировать стейты по группам интентов, а не по одному конкретному.
- Подключить базу знаний через глобальный тег
intentGroup!
.
intentGroup
и intentGroup!
Изменение таймаута при событии speechNotRecognized
Событие speechNotRecognized
возникает,
если абонент молчал в течение 5 секунд, или бот не смог распознать речь абонента в течение этого времени.
Теперь вы можете изменить этот таймаут с помощью метода $dialer.setNoInputTimeout
.
Новый метод можно использовать для реализации активного слушания. Оно может быть полезно, если ваш бот часто перебивает абонента.
Обновление модели управления доступами
В ноябре мы представили обновленную модель управления доступами. Теперь доступы к возможностям JAICP разделяются по ролям исходя из задач пользователей в группах проектов.
Появились новые роли:
- Роль BUSINESS_OWNER с возможностью просмотра групп проектов и управления тарифами.
- Роль OUTBOUND_MANAGER для управления исходящими коммуникациями.
- Роль SYSTEM_ADMIN для управления системными настройками.
- Специализированная роль SECURITY_ADMIN для управления настройками безопасности.
- Специализированная роль USER_ADMIN для управления доступами пользователей.
Конфигурационный файл NLU
В ранее созданных проектах конфигурационный файл NLU называется caila_import.json
, новые проекты по умолчанию создаются с конфигурационным файлом nlu.json
. Никаких изменений в работе текущих проектов не произойдет.